dc.descriptionWe make an estimation of the value of the Gromov norm of the Cartesian product of two surfaces. Our method uses a connection between these norms and the minimal size of triangulations of the products of two polygons. This allows us to prove that the Gromov norm of this product is between 32 and 52 when both factors have genus 2. The case of arbitrary genera is easy to deduce form this one.
dc.descriptionThe journal version contains an error that invalidates one direction of the main theorem. The present version contains an erratum, at the end, explaining this
